Les Misérables is like a short-term relationship: stressful, suspenseful and ends horribly.
Seriously, I was all set to give this film about the injustices in the Parisian suburbs a 'recommend' because of its energy, intensity and relevance (but despite its lack of originality and weak lead actor), until the lazy ending which gives 'misérable' a new meaning.
